I was looking into etherpad-lite as a possible basis
for a service to help
with concurrent editing. Still haven't made a decision there whether it is
a
good basis or if we should write our own (should we even want to do
concurrent editing).
I am told that etherpad-lite is a bit less stable than etherpad, but I'd
like to try running it ourselves to see for sure. The main benefit of
etherpad-lite is that it doesn't run in a byzantine Java-based JavaScript
environment kludged together in 2008; it's much more modern. So there are
fewer things for us to comprehend, if we want to get serious about such
kinds of services.
